Water Filtration Plant - The Process
Water Filtration Plant - The Process. Print Raw water contains undesirable sediments, colour, algae (which can produce a taste and smell) and other harmful organisms. The Water Filtration Plant (WFP) is designed to remove this undesirable matter, and produce water fit and safe for drinking.

Filtration Processes | IWA Publishing
Filtration is a process that removes particles from suspension in water. Removal takes place by a number of mechanisms that include straining, flocculation, sedimentation and surface capture. Filters can be categorised by the main method of capture, i.e. exclusion of particles at the surface of the filter media i.e. straining, or deposition within the media i.e. in-depth

Wastewater treatment - Primary treatment | Britannica
Wastewater treatment - Wastewater treatment - Primary treatment: Primary treatment removes material that will either float or readily settle out by gravity. It includes the physical processes of screening, comminution, grit removal, and sedimentation. Screens are made of long, closely spaced, narrow metal bars. They block floating debris such as wood, rags, and other bulky objects that could ...

Ironfilter - Water Treatment and Purification - Lenntech
Plant principle: First, air is injected in order to oxidize the iron. The oxidized iron will then precipitate on a sand filter. An MnO2 layer in the sand bed will catalyze the oxidation of residual iron. Backwash will be done by water and by air. More on iron removal principles. Iron removal plant flow diagram:

Croton Water Filtration Plant - Water Technology
The Croton water filtration plant entered service in 2015. The plant ended a long, occasionally controversial, saga that began back in 1989. The plant represents a significant step in improving the water quality of the million New Yorkers who rely on the Croton water system, the city's oldest, which first began service in 1842.
